Transaction 3faa05210061d57b79c6dba189c0aaac73dac29bf6d195983276a88ddff1760c
1 Input
1 Output
-
3faa05210061d57b79c6dba189c0aaac73dac29bf6d195983276a88ddff1760c:0
- value
- 24110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0db870ffb5deabb1a6cd50bb681cc6a51773542c OP_EQUAL
- address
- 32wZfFVzY5tEutnb84CYFUdR4KRQ33kDXt